No, it's not new. From [0]: Update the bug report description and make sure it contains the following information: [...] Detailed instructions how to reproduce the bug. These should allow someone who is not familiar with the affected package to reproduce the bug and verify that the updated package fixes the problem. Please mark this with a line "TEST CASE:".
It's so that the SRU can be verified easily (and therefore copied from -proposed to -updates). Makes the work of SRU verifiers easier if all of the information they need is in one place.
